2600 rev/min is equivalent to which of the following?

2600 rad/s

86.67 rad/s

272.27 rad/s

136.14 rad/s

2.

MULTIPLE CHOICE QUESTION

5 mins • 1 pt

A 0.12-m-radius grinding wheel takes 5.5 s to speed up from 2.0 rad/s to 11.0 rad/s. What is the wheel's average angular acceleration?

0.20 rad/s/s

4.81 rad/s/s

3.12 rad/s/s

1.63 rad/s/s

3.

MULTIPLE CHOICE QUESTION

5 mins • 1 pt

A spool of thread has an average radius of 1.00 cm. If the spool contains 62.8 m of thread, about how many turns of thread are on the spool? "Average radius" allows us to not need to treat the layering of threads on lower layers.

100

1000

10,000

10

4.

MULTIPLE CHOICE QUESTION

5 mins • 1 pt

A 0.30m radius automobile tire rotates how many radians after starting from rest and accelerating at a constant 2.0 rad/s2 over a 5.0 s interval?

25 rad

12.5 rad

2 rad

0.5 rad

5.

MULTIPLE CHOICE QUESTION

5 mins • 1 pt

A fan blade, initially at rest, rotates with a constant acceleration of 0.025 rad/s2. What is its angular speed at the instant it goes through an angular displacement of 4.2 rad?

0.025 rad/s

0.11 rad/s

0.46 rad/s

0.21 rad/s

6.

MULTIPLE CHOICE QUESTION

5 mins • 1 pt

A fan blade, initially at rest, rotates with a constant acceleration of 0.025 rad/s2. What is the time interval required for it to reach a 4.2 rad displacement after starting from rest

12.96 s

168 s

336 s

18.33 s
